vue的express是什么

fiy 其他 98

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ue.js 是一个用于构建用户界面的渐进式框架,而 Express 是一个基于 Node.js 平台的 Web 应用程序框架。Vue.js 与 Express 有着不同的用途和功能。

    Vue.js 的主要作用是构建用户界面,它采用了组件化的方式来开发,为开发者提供了一种简洁、高效的方式来构建交互式的前端应用程序。Vue.js 支持双向数据绑定、组件化开发、虚拟 DOM 等特性,使开发者能够更加方便地开发和维护复杂的前端应用。

    而 Express 是一个轻量级的 Web 应用程序框架,它提供了一套简单、灵活的方法来处理 HTTP 请求和响应。Express 提供了路由、中间件等功能,使开发者能够更加方便地构建服务器端的 Web 应用程序。Express 可以与各种模板引擎和数据库进行集成,使开发者可以根据自己的需求选择最适合的工具。

    在实际开发中,Vue.js 和 Express 可以配合使用。前端使用 Vue.js 构建用户界面,后端使用 Express 构建接口与数据库交互。Vue.js 可以通过 AJAX 或 axios 等方式向 Express 发送请求,并根据接口返回的数据更新用户界面。Express 可以处理这些请求,并将数据存储到数据库中。通过这种方式,前端和后端可以实现数据的交互和共享,从而实现一个完整的 Web 应用程序。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ue的Express是一个结合使用Vue.js和Express.js的全栈JavaScript框架。Vue.js是一个用于构建用户界面的渐进式框架,而Express.js是一个基于Node.js的Web应用程序框架。

    1. 前后端分离:Vue的Express允许开发人员将前端和后端逻辑分离,前端使用Vue.js来构建用户界面,后端使用Express.js来处理服务器端请求和数据库操作。这种分离可以使开发更加模块化和可维护。

    2. RESTful API:Express提供了丰富的HTTP请求方法和中间件,使开发人员能够快速和灵活地构建RESTful API,供Vue.js前端调用。这样的API设计方式可以将前后端解耦,使得前后端开发能够并行进行。

    3. 单页应用:Vue.js是一个用于构建单页应用的框架,它通过组件化的方式实现了前端页面的模块化。结合Express.js后端的接口设计,前端使用Vue.js可以快速开发用户交互界面,实现单页应用的高效加载和交互体验。

    4. 数据库操作:Express.js提供了一些中间件,如mongoose,可方便地与MongoDB进行交互。使用Vue的Express,可以轻松地在前后端之间传递数据,并将数据存储在数据库中。这种整合可以节省开发时间和精力,提高开发效率。

    5. 综合优势:Vue的Express结合了Vue.js和Express.js的优点,使得开发者可以同时享受到前端框架的灵活性和可扩展性,以及后端框架的高效处理能力和数据库操作便利性。这种结合能够提供一种全栈开发的便捷方式,适用于开发各种规模的应用程序。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ue的Express是指在Vue项目中使用Express框架来搭建后端服务器的一种方式。Express是一个基于Node.js的后端框架,它提供了一系列的方法和中间件,用于简化和加速服务器端开发。

    使用Vue的Express可以实现前后端的分离开发,前端使用Vue框架负责处理用户界面和交互逻辑,后端使用Express框架负责处理数据的存储和获取、处理业务逻辑等。

    下面是使用Vue的Express的一般操作流程:

    1. 安装Node.js和Vue CLI
      首先,需要安装Node.js和Vue CLI工具。Node.js用于运行服务器端JavaScript,而Vue CLI是Vue的脚手架工具,可以方便地搭建Vue项目。

    2. 创建Vue项目
      使用Vue CLI创建一个新的Vue项目,可以使用命令行工具或者Vue UI界面进行创建。创建完成后,可以运行项目,并通过浏览器访问Vue应用的默认页面。

    3. 安装Express和其他依赖
      在项目的根目录下,使用npm或者yarn安装Express框架和其他需要的依赖。可以在package.json文件中添加相应的依赖,并运行npm install或者yarn install命令来安装。

    4. 创建和配置Express服务器
      在项目根目录下创建一个server.js(或者其他名称)的文件,用于编写Express服务器的代码。在该文件中引入Express模块,并创建一个Express实例。接着,可以配置Express服务器,例如设置路由、中间件等。

    5. 连接Vue前端和Express后端
      前端通过发送HTTP请求与后端通信。可以使用Vue的axios库来发送请求,axios是一个基于Promise的HTTP客户端,可以在Vue项目中方便地进行Ajax交互。在Vue组件中,可以使用axios发送GET、POST等请求,与后端交换数据。

    6. 启动服务器
      在server.js文件中,添加启动服务器的代码。一般使用Express的listen方法,指定服务器的端口号。在终端中运行node server.js命令,启动Express服务器。

    通过以上步骤,就可以将Vue前端和Express后端连接起来,实现前后端分离开发。前端负责渲染用户界面和处理交互逻辑,后端负责处理数据存储和业务逻辑。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部